Coroner releases name of driver dead after single-vehicle Newberry County collision

NEWBERRY COUNTY, S.C. (WOLO)– A driver is dead after a single-vehicle Monday morning collision in Newberry County, said state troopers.

The collision happened on Ira Kinard Road about four miles south of Prosperity around 7:50 a.m. on Dec. 18.

According to the South Carolina Highway Patrol, a 2000 Toyota traveling west on Ira Kinard Road went off the right side of the road, then it went off the left side of the road and hit some trees.

Newberry County Coroner Laura Kneece has identified the individual as David R. Nassef, 60, of Columbia.

The collision is under investigation by the South Carolina Highway Patrol and the Newberry County Coroner’s Office.
